Hefei Fengle Seed Co Ltd

SDIC Fengle Seed Co., Ltd. manufactures and sells seeds, agrochemicals, and spices in China and internationally. Its seed offerings include hybrid corn, silage corn, hybrid rice, conventional rice, wheat, watermelon and cantaloupe, and rapeseed. The company also provides pesticides, fertilizers, natural mint products such as menthol and peppermint oil, synthetic cooling agents, and fine chemical products including p-toluenesulfonyl chloride. Formerly known as Hefei Fengle Seed Co., Ltd., it changed its name to SDIC Fengle Seed Co., Ltd. in August 2025. Founded in 1997, it is based in Hefei, China.

SDIC Fengle Completes Transfer of 60% Equity Stake in SDIC Jinzhong

SDIC Fengle Seed Industry Company Limited announced that the transfer of the underlying assets for its acquisition of a 60% equity stake in SDIC Zhangye Jinzhong Technology Company Limited has been completed, and SDIC Jinzhong has become a controlling subsidiary of the company. The company has paid 50% of the equity transfer consideration to the transferor, SDIC Seed Industry, amounting to 16.8824 million yuan. The transaction was approved by the board of directors on June 25, 2026, and approved by the extraordinary general meeting of shareholders on July 14. SDIC Jinzhong has a registered capital of 500 million yuan, was established in November 2024, and is mainly engaged in the production and operation of crop seeds. The company stated that the remaining transaction price still needs to be paid, and the relevant parties will continue to fulfill their agreement commitments.

Guotou Fengle reports net loss of 31.2 million yuan in 2026 interim report

Guotou Fengle released its 2026 interim report, with net profit attributable to the parent company at a loss of 31.2 million yuan, an increase of 3.18 million yuan compared with the same period last year. The company's total operating revenue was 1.195 billion yuan, up 3.88 percent year on year. Net cash outflow from operating activities was 96.57 million yuan, an increase of 8.13 million yuan over the same period last year, marking a second consecutive year of growth. The company's latest asset-liability ratio was 32.08 percent, gross margin was 12.02 percent, and diluted earnings per share was negative 0.04 yuan.

SDIC Fengle's First-Half Loss Widens; Noted Retail Investor Xia Chongyang Appears Among Top Ten Shareholders

SDIC Fengle's first-half loss widened year on year, while noted retail investor Xia Chongyang entered the company's list of top ten shareholders. In the first half, the company achieved operating revenue of 1.195 billion yuan, up 3.88 percent year on year. Net profit attributable to shareholders of the listed company was a loss of 31.2 million yuan, compared with a loss of 28.03 million yuan in the same period last year. Net profit after deducting non-recurring items was a loss of 37.04 million yuan, compared with a loss of 31.27 million yuan a year earlier. By business segment, corn seed revenue rose 115.91 percent year on year, but rice seed revenue fell 19.66 percent, and agrochemical revenue declined 1.07 percent. As of June 30, Xia Chongyang held 9.95 million shares, accounting for 1.25 percent of the company's total share capital. The company also plans to transfer a 51 percent stake in its subsidiary Fengle Agrochemical through public listing, and to acquire a 60 percent stake in SDIC Zhangye Golden Seed Technology Company held by SDIC Seed Industry.

SDIC Fengle expects first-half loss of up to 33 million yuan as fertilizer and fragrance profits decline

SDIC Fengle has issued its 2026 first-half performance forecast, projecting a net loss attributable to the parent of 28 million to 33 million yuan, compared with a loss of 28.03 million yuan in the same period last year. The company said profits from its seed and agrochemical businesses increased year on year, but profits from the fertilizer business fell due to lower gross margins on concentrate powder, and profits from the fragrance business declined because of higher depreciation at the new plant. The previously disclosed first-quarter report showed a net loss attributable to the parent of 16.75 million yuan, widening from the same period a year earlier.
